If Marangu is the "Coca Cola" route, then the Machame Route is the "whiskey" route. It is the second most popular and one of the most scenic route on the mountains. All climbers sleep in tents (tents are included) and meals are served in a dinner tent or on a blanket outside. It is done over 6 days, so acclimatization is easier, and the success rate is fairly high. With the Machame/South Circuit route, you will circle halfway around the mountain with great views from all angles. This route is approximately 40 km versus 20 km on the Marangu route. It is for physically fit people with some hiking experience.

DAY 1: Arrive at Kilimanjaro International Airport, transfer to the hotel in Moshi or Arusha. Evening briefing and packing of mountain gear.

DAY 2: Breakfast, drive from your hotel in Moshi/Arusha to Machame gate (about 45min.). After about an hour of registration and park fees payments, start climbing along a clear trail through plantation and natural forest, thereafter a narrow forest path follows to the Machame hut (9,900ft), B.L.D.

DAY 3: Breakfast, ascending through the forest, steep ridge passing through heather and open moorlands, and crossing a large gorge to Shira hut (12,600ft). The distance is about 5-6 hours.

DAY 4: After breakfast, we will ascend to Lava tower (15,180ft) with lunch on the way to Baranco, then descend slowly to Baranco hut (12,850ft) for dinner and overnight, B, L ,D. DAY

Day 5: After breakfast, we leave Baranco hut for Barafu hut (14,910ft). We will pass through the last water drop at Karanga valley on the way up. Overnight Barafu hut, B, L, D.

DAY 6: Wake up at midnight, and after a small snack, start ascending to Uhuru Peak through the Stella point (18,640ft), then after reaching the summit, we will head down to Mweka hut () for dinner and overnight, B, L, D.

DAY 7: After breakfast, we will head down to Mweka gate with lunch packet, and the waiting vehicle will take you to your hotel in Moshi/Arusha, B, L.
